Ticket #misc — missed pick-up. The Skylark-4 survey drone scheduled for collection yesterday was not retrieved; it remains crated at the Dunmarsh receiving dock, fully powered down with the battery removed as required. Collection has been rebooked for tomorrow between 09:00 and 11:00. Please observe the hand-over instruction below when the courier arrives.

dispatch memo: the lamwyn fenwyn courier leaves the wenir ledger at gate 7175 under passcode 822969

**Vendor note: Inkmill markdown pipeline**

Rendering for Parchway docs is outsourced to Inkmill under an annual contract, renewing each March. They handle sanitization and PDF export; we own the upload queue. SLA: 4-hour response on rendering failures. Escalate only after two failed retries. Their support desk is reachable at the address below.

billing contact of hahaf-baguf = zorael.tammir.jorius@sivrelhq.internal

// Heads up for support folks: WAVE_PREVIEW_BUCKETS controls how many
// amplitude samples we squish the audio into for the little waveform
// preview in Chirpdeck. If a customer says the preview looks "blocky,"
// this number is why — we trade detail for fast rendering on long files.
// Don't suggest changing it without checking with the playback team.
// The build this default shipped in is noted below.

trace token, kahog-tajeg: htk6_97d963

Cold starts on Vexlet serverless handlers inflate CI timing checks. First invocation after deploy can take 4–6s; the perf gate assumes warm latency. Don't chase phantom regressions. Fix: the pipeline now fires a warm-up ping before timing runs. If the gate still fails, the warm-up step likely errored. Check its log and the trace token printed below.

pipeline stamp: htk3_69f